  • PSA Levels by Age Chart: Normal Ranges, and What They Mean
    Normal PSA Levels by Age Normal PSA levels vary by age group For men aged 40-49, the average PSA level is around 0 72 ng mL Men aged 50-59 usually have an average PSA level of 1 1 ng mL The average PSA for men aged 60-69 is approximately 1 5 ng mL, and for men aged 70-79, it is about 2 0 ng mL

  • Chart: NCCN Guidelines for Early Detection (Age, Risk Factors . . .
    If PSA is less than or equal to 3 ng mL and DRE normal (if done), repeat testing every 1 - 2 years If PSA is more than 3 ng mL and or a very suspicious DRE, talk with your doctor about further testing Age 75+ Talk with your doctor about if prostate cancer screening should continue Testing after age 74 is recommended only in very healthy
